Tall tales and fishing lore from Kiwi fishing personality Cliff Barnes. As he looks back over his adventurous life, Cliff Barnes muses that he must have used up eight of his nine lives while fishing along the Northland coast but, on a recount, concedes he has used up the lot. Among his many scrapes with death was the time his boat was smashed against rocks and sank. Then there was time when he fell overboard and was left fully clothed and treading water as his pilotless boat motored away into the distance.
